The A9K-24X10GE-1G-FC= is a 24-port 10 Gigabit Ethernet line card for Cisco’s ASR 9000 Series routers, tailored for networks requiring granular bandwidth scalability. Unlike fixed-license modules, it operates on Cisco’s Flexible Consumption (FC) model, enabling operators to activate 1G increments of capacity on demand. This makes it ideal for environments with fluctuating traffic, such as 5G mobile cores or cloud-edge deployments.

Q: How does 1G-FC licensing work with 10G ports?
A: Each 10G port can be subdivided into ten 1G segments, allowing precise allocation. For example, assign 5G to a critical link and 1G to low-priority traffic.
Q: Is there a penalty for reducing licensed capacity?
A: No—Cisco’s FC model permits monthly adjustments without long-term commitments or fees.
Q: Does the card support backward compatibility with non-FC ASR 9000 systems?
A: Yes, but FC licensing requires a Cisco IOS XR 7.5.1+ software stack and compatible chassis (e.g., ASR-9904/9912).
Q: Can MACsec be enabled on FC-licensed ports?
A: Yes, but encryption consumes 2x licensed capacity (e.g., 1G encrypted traffic uses 2G of FC credits).
